The Charity

Be Free Young Carers is the only specialist organisation supporting young carers in Oxfordshire and receives no statutory funding. Based in Didcot, they have been supporting young carers aged 8 to 17 years across South Oxfordshire, The Vale of White Horse and Oxford City for the past 29 years through their emotional and practical advice giving.
